tetrandrine
English
Etymology
From translingual Stephania tetrandra (“a plant in which it is found”) + -ine.
Noun
tetrandrine (uncountable)
- (organic chemistry, pharmacology) A benzylisoquinoline alkaloid that is a calcium channel blocker and isolated from Stephania tetrandra - C38H42N2O6.
